Easy Gluten Free Pear and Ginger Crumble Cake

A simple moist bake, great for using over ripe pears. This Pear and Ginger Crumble Cake is made using gluten free ingredients and has no dairy or egg in it so it is vegan too. A prefect autumnal bake to enjoy with a cup of tea with friends or in peace.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time25 minutes
Total Time35 minutes

Servings: 9 squares

Ingredients

For the sponge

  • 3 pears peeled, cored and cut into small cubes
  • 200 g gluten free self-raising flour
  • 100 g butter or butter alternative (I use Flora plant butter)
  • 100 g light brown sugar
  • 120 ml dairy free milk
  • 1 tsp ground ginger
  • 1 tsp flaxseed
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• ½ tsp psyllium husk powder (optional) optional

For the crumble topping

  • 100 g gluten free granola
  • ½ tsp ginger
  • 1 tbsp light brown sugar

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 190°C | 170°C fan | 375°F | Gas 5
  • Line the bottom of a 20cm/8inch square tin with baking paper and grease the sides
  • In a large bowl cream together the ‘butter’ and light brown sugar until light and fluffy.
  • Add the flax seeds, psyllium husk if using, ginger and vanilla extract and beat again.
  • Then add the flour and soya milk a bit at a time beating the ingredients all the time until thoroughly incorporated.
  • Finally fold in the cubes of pear.
  • Spoon the cake batter into the prepared square tin and with the back of a spoon or silicone spatula smooth into the corners.
  • Measure out the gluten free granola and add the ginger and sugar and shake the crumble mix over the top of the cake batter.
  • Pop into the oven for 20mins and at this point check to see if it has baked in the middle by inserting a cocktail stick or wooden skewer, if the stick is not clean and the bake it starting to catch (go to dark in colour) cover loosely with some foil and return to the oven for another 5mins.
  • Once cooked through remove from oven and allow to cool completely before cutting into 9 equal size squares.
